mussitation

/ˌmʌsɪˈteɪʃən/
noun
  1. The act of muttering or mumbling; low, indistinct speech.
    • I heard a faint mussitation coming from the next room.
    • His mussitation was so quiet that no one could understand his request.
    • The room was filled with the soft mussitation of people praying.
